City Spire was designed by Murphy/Jahn architects. This 73-story postmodern skyscraper features a striking octagonal design and houses 340 residences. It is located across the street from famed Carnegie Hall, steps away from Central Park, Columbus Circle, and the Theatre District, surrounded by the best restaurants and shopping the city has to offer.
